config/sysinv/sysinv/sysinv/sysinv/puppet
Patrick Bonnell 3347cd311a Set primary interface of active backup bond interface
The standby controller would potentially fail to boot while
attempting to PXE-boot when configured with a management LAG.

This commit determines the interface with the lowest slave MAC
address in an active_standby LAG configuration and assigns it
as the primary interface.

Story: 2002865
Task: 22814

Change-Id: I73f03cb9cb2fd632a1e64b4e7744e3be067318a4
Signed-off-by: Jack Ding <jack.ding@windriver.com>
2018-07-20 15:30:54 -04:00
..
__init__.py Open vSwitch integration with host and configuration framework 2018-06-14 16:03:52 -05:00
aodh.py Fixing Pep8 errors of type F841 2018-07-20 13:33:47 -04:00
base.py Initial kubernetes config on controller 2018-06-29 13:44:43 -04:00
ceilometer.py Sysinv. Cleanup import statements for pep8 2018-06-29 13:43:53 -04:00
ceph.py Use default value if mon_lv_size not set 2018-07-06 09:10:09 -04:00
cinder.py Set cinder default_volume_type via service parameters 2018-06-28 22:07:38 -04:00
common.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
dcmanager.py Fixing Pep8 errors of type F841 2018-07-20 13:33:47 -04:00
dcorch.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
device.py Fixing Pep8 errors of type E121 2018-07-20 13:34:03 -04:00
glance.py Sysinv. Cleanup import statements for pep8 2018-06-29 13:43:53 -04:00
gnocchi.py Fixing Pep8 errors of type F841 2018-07-20 13:33:47 -04:00
heat.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
horizon.py Sysinv. Cleanup import statements for pep8 2018-06-29 13:43:53 -04:00
interface.py Set primary interface of active backup bond interface 2018-07-20 15:30:54 -04:00
inventory.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
ironic.py Sysinv. Cleanup import statements for pep8 2018-06-29 13:43:53 -04:00
keystone.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
kubernetes.py Initial kubernetes config on compute 2018-06-29 13:44:44 -04:00
ldap.py Support shared LDAP share in region config 2018-06-28 22:07:38 -04:00
magnum.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
mtce.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
murano.py Sysinv. Cleanup import statements for pep8 2018-06-29 13:43:53 -04:00
networking.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
neutron.py Sysinv. Cleanup import statements for pep8 2018-06-29 13:43:53 -04:00
nfv.py Open vSwitch integration with host and configuration framework 2018-06-14 16:03:52 -05:00
nova.py Fixing Pep8 errors of type F841 2018-07-20 13:33:47 -04:00
openstack.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
ovs.py Open vSwitch integration with host and configuration framework 2018-06-14 16:03:52 -05:00
panko.py Fixing Pep8 errors of type F841 2018-07-20 13:33:47 -04:00
patching.py StarlingX open source release updates 2018-05-31 07:35:52 -07:00
platform.py Initial changes to enable new upgrades 2018-07-06 09:10:22 -04:00
puppet.py Initial kubernetes config on compute 2018-06-29 13:44:44 -04:00
service_parameter.py Sysinv. Cleanup import statements for pep8 2018-06-29 13:43:53 -04:00
storage.py Fixing Pep8 errors of type E121 2018-07-20 13:34:03 -04:00